Back
Day Range
$368.44
$375.97
52-Week Range
$368.44
$623.61
Volume
349,724
50D / 200D Avg
$435.41
/
$451.32
Prev Close
$373.89
Quick Summary
Price History
Financial Trends
Peer Comparison
vs Healthcare sector median (631 peers)
| Metric | Stock | Sector Median |
|---|---|---|
| P/E | 19.9 | 0.2 |
| P/B | 5.4 | 3.0 |
| ROE % | 25.3 | 3.6 |
| Net Margin % | 10.5 | 3.8 |
| Rev Growth 5Y % | 4.3 | 10.0 |
| D/E | 0.2 | 0.2 |
Analyst Price Target
Hold
$475.00
+27.0%
Forward P/E
15.67
Forward EPS
$23.88
EPS Growth (est.)
+0.0%
Est. Revenue
2.67B
Earnings Estimates
| Period | EPS Est. | Revenue Est. | Analysts |
|---|---|---|---|
| FY2028 |
$28.90
$28.76 – $29.06
|
3.00B | 1 |
| FY2027 |
$26.62
$26.07 – $27.17
|
2.83B | 2 |
| FY2026 |
$23.88
$23.77 – $23.97
|
2.67B | 2 |
No quarterly estimates available
Earnings Surprises
Last 8 quarters
| Quarter | Est. EPS | Actual EPS | Surprise |
|---|---|---|---|
| 2026-02-25 | $7.03 | $6.42 | -8.7% |
| 2025-10-28 | $5.39 | $5.27 | -2.2% |
| 2025-07-29 | $4.78 | $4.27 | -10.7% |
| 2025-04-23 | $5.55 | $5.63 | +1.4% |
| 2025-02-26 | $6.78 | $6.83 | +0.7% |
| 2024-10-29 | $5.76 | $5.64 | -2.1% |
| 2024-07-24 | $5.59 | $5.47 | -2.1% |
| 2024-04-24 | $5.48 | $5.20 | -5.1% |
Dividend History
7 yr streakYield
0.01%
Payout Ratio
0.12%
Growth (3Y)
14.13%
Growth (5Y)
10.76%
| Ex-Date | Payment Date | Amount | Yield |
|---|---|---|---|
| Feb 23, 2026 | Mar 13, 2026 | $0.60 | 0.48% |
| Nov 17, 2025 | Dec 05, 2025 | $0.60 | 0.51% |
| Aug 11, 2025 | Aug 29, 2025 | $0.60 | 0.49% |
| May 29, 2025 | Jun 17, 2025 | $0.50 | 0.35% |
| Feb 24, 2025 | Mar 14, 2025 | $0.50 | 0.35% |
| Nov 18, 2024 | Dec 06, 2024 | $0.50 | 0.32% |
| Aug 12, 2024 | Aug 30, 2024 | $0.50 | 0.30% |
| May 30, 2024 | Jun 18, 2024 | $0.40 | 0.29% |
| Feb 23, 2024 | Mar 15, 2024 | $0.40 | 0.26% |
| Nov 10, 2023 | Dec 04, 2023 | $0.40 | 0.27% |
| Aug 11, 2023 | Sep 05, 2023 | $0.40 | 0.30% |
| May 24, 2023 | Jun 14, 2023 | $0.38 | 0.28% |
| Feb 24, 2023 | Mar 17, 2023 | $0.38 | 0.28% |
| Nov 10, 2022 | Dec 05, 2022 | $0.38 | 0.30% |
| Aug 12, 2022 | Sep 02, 2022 | $0.38 | 0.30% |
| May 25, 2022 | Jun 15, 2022 | $0.36 | 0.29% |
| Feb 25, 2022 | Mar 18, 2022 | $0.36 | 0.30% |
| Nov 12, 2021 | Dec 06, 2021 | $0.36 | 0.28% |
| Aug 13, 2021 | Sep 02, 2021 | $0.36 | 0.30% |
| May 26, 2021 | Jun 16, 2021 | $0.34 | 0.27% |
Key Takeaways
Revenue grew 4.28% annually over 5 years — modest growth
Earnings declined -12.17% over the past year
ROE of 25.28% indicates high profitability
Debt/Equity of 0.16 — conservative balance sheet
Generating 325.48M in free cash flow
Cash machine — converts 122.71% of earnings into free cash flow
Growth
Revenue Growth (5Y)
4.28%
Revenue (1Y)4.06%
Earnings (1Y)-12.17%
FCF Growth (3Y)9.10%
Quality
Return on Equity
25.28%
ROIC22.37%
Net Margin10.48%
Op. Margin13.37%
Safety
Debt / Equity
0.16
Current Ratio1.05
Interest Coverage193.28
Valuation
P/E Ratio
19.90
Forward P/E15.67
P/B Ratio5.39
EV/EBITDA15.84
Dividend Yield0.01%
All Fundamental Metrics
| Growth | |||
| Revenue Growth (1Y) | 4.06% | Revenue Growth (3Y) | 5.70% |
| Earnings Growth (1Y) | -12.17% | Earnings Growth (3Y) | -1.34% |
| Revenue Growth (5Y) | 4.28% | Earnings Growth (5Y) | -0.31% |
| Profitability | |||
| Revenue (TTM) | 2.53B | Net Income (TTM) | 265.24M |
| ROE | 25.28% | ROA | 16.17% |
| Gross Margin | 29.97% | Operating Margin | 13.37% |
| Net Margin | 10.48% | Free Cash Flow (TTM) | 325.48M |
| ROIC | 22.37% | FCF Growth (3Y) | 9.10% |
| Safety | |||
| Debt / Equity | 0.16 | Current Ratio | 1.05 |
| Interest Coverage | 193.28 | ||
| Dividends | |||
| Dividend Yield | 0.01% | Payout Ratio | 0.12% |
| Dividend Growth (3Y) | 14.13% | Dividend Growth (5Y) | 10.76% |
| Consecutive Div Years | 7 yrs | ||
| Valuation | |||
| P/E Ratio | 19.90 | Forward P/E | 15.67 |
| P/B Ratio | 5.39 | P/S Ratio | 2.09 |
| PEG Ratio | -2.78 | Forward PEG | N/A |
| EV/EBITDA | 15.84 | Fwd EV/EBITDA | 10.94 |
| Forward P/S | 1.98 | Fwd Earnings Yield | 6.38% |
| FCF Yield | 6.17% | ||
| Market Cap | 5.28B | Enterprise Value | 5.36B |
Income Statement
Annual, most recent first
| Metric | FY2025 | FY2024 | FY2023 | FY2022 | FY2021 |
|---|---|---|---|---|---|
| Revenue | 2.53B | 2.43B | 2.26B | 2.13B | 2.14B |
| Net Income | 265.24M | 302.00M | 272.51M | 249.62M | 268.55M |
| EPS (Diluted) | 18.42 | 19.89 | 17.93 | 16.53 | 16.85 |
| Gross Profit | 758.34M | 854.35M | 798.82M | 765.09M | 769.80M |
| Operating Income | 338.25M | 366.49M | 340.57M | 343.50M | 343.04M |
Balance Sheet
Annual, most recent first
| Metric | FY2025 | FY2024 | FY2023 | FY2022 | FY2021 |
|---|---|---|---|---|---|
| Total Assets | 1.64B | 1.67B | 1.67B | 1.44B | 1.34B |
| Total Liabilities | 660.61M | 549.58M | 560.22M | 643.30M | 719.45M |
| Shareholders' Equity | 979.41M | 1.12B | 1.11B | 798.72M | 623.27M |
| Total Debt | 154.76M | 140.84M | 155.11M | 247.01M | 323.54M |
| Cash & Equivalents | 74.52M | 178.35M | 263.96M | 74.13M | 32.90M |
| Current Assets | 302.62M | 394.75M | 500.84M | 272.61M | 230.29M |
| Current Liabilities | 287.13M | 285.70M | 312.05M | 297.21M | 302.40M |
